Overview
The AD9236BRURL7-80 is a monolithic, single-supply, 12-bit analog-to-digital converter operating at an 80 MSPS sampling rate. It utilizes a multistage differential pipelined architecture with output error correction logic to ensure no missing codes across the full industrial temperature range of −40°C to +85°C. The device features a high-performance sample-and-hold amplifier and an on-chip voltage reference. It operates from a single 3 V supply (2.7 V to 3.6 V) and consumes 366 mW of power. The ADC provides a differential input with a 500 MHz bandwidth and supports flexible analog input ranges from 1 V p-p to 2 V p-p.
Feature Summary
- Features a patented sample-and-hold amplifier input that maintains excellent performance for input frequencies up to 100 MHz.
- Includes a clock duty cycle stabilizer to compensate for wide variations in clock pulse width while maintaining overall ADC performance.
- Offers a separate digital output driver supply to accommodate both 2.5 V and 3.3 V logic families.

Part Context
The AD9236 belongs to Analog Devices' family of high-speed, low-power analog-to-digital converters. It is designed to bridge the gap between lower-resolution devices like the AD9215 and higher-speed options like the AD9245. The device is fabricated on an advanced CMOS process and is available in both 28-lead TSSOP and 32-lead LFCSP packages. It is specified over the industrial temperature range, making it suitable for a broad range of commercial and industrial applications.
Replacement Considerations
The AD9236 is pin-compatible with the AD9215, AD9235, and AD9245. These parts can serve as direct replacements for migration purposes, allowing transitions between different bit resolutions and sampling rates without redesigning the PCB footprint.
FAQ
What is the pipeline delay of the AD9236?
The AD9236 has a pipeline delay, also known as latency, of 7 cycles.
How does the AD9236 handle out-of-range signals?
The device includes an Out-of-Range (OTR) signal that indicates an overflow condition. This bit can be used in conjunction with the most significant bit to determine whether the overflow is low or high.
Can the AD9236 operate with single-ended inputs?
Yes, the wide bandwidth, truly differential sample-and-hold amplifier allows for user-selectable input ranges and common modes, including single-ended applications.
